Sea level rise may drive coastal nesting birds to extinction

Thursday, June 1, 2017 - 08:02 in Earth & Climate

Rising sea levels and more frequent flooding events may drive coastal nesting birds around the world to extinction, a team of international researchers say following their 20-year study of Eurasian oystercatchers.
